系统环境:

型号名称: MacBook Pro
型号标识符: MacBookPro11,4
处理器名称: Intel Core i7
处理器速度: 2.8 GHz
处理器数目: 1
核总数: 4
L2 缓存(每个核): 256 KB
L3 缓存: 6 MB
内存: 16 GB

软件版本:

IntelliJ IDEA 2017.2.4
Build #IU-172.4155.36, built on September 12, 2017
Licensed to phpdragon

JRE: 1.8.0_152-release-915-b11 x86_64
JVM: OpenJDK 64-Bit Server VM by JetBrains s.r.o
Mac OS X 10.12.6

启动参数配置:

-server
-Xms4400m
-Xmx4400m
-Xmn1000m
-XX:PermSize=768m
-XX:MaxPermSize=768m
-Xss512K
-XX:ReservedCodeCacheSize=128m
-XX:SurvivorRatio=1
-XX:+UseParNewGC
-XX:+UseConcMarkSweepGC
-XX:+UseCMSCompactAtFullCollection
-XX:+UseCMSInitiatingOccupancyOnly
-XX:CMSInitiatingOccupancyFraction=70
-XX:+CMSParallelRemarkEnabled
-XX:+CMSClassUnloadingEnabled
-XX:CMSFullGCsBeforeCompaction=0
-XX:LargePageSizeInBytes=200M
-Dsun.io.useCanonCaches=false
-Djava.net.preferIPv4Stack=true
-Dsun.rmi.dgc.client.gcInterval=10800000
-Dsun.rmi.dgc.server.gcInterval=10800000
-XX:SoftRefLRUPolicyMSPerMB=0
-XX:+DisableExplicitGC
-XX:+PrintClassHistogram
-XX:+PrintGCDetails
-XX:+PrintGCTimeStamps
-XX:+PrintHeapAtGC
-Xloggc:gc.log-XX:ErrorFile=$USER_HOME/java_error_in_idea_%p.log
-XX:HeapDumpPath=$USER_HOME/java_error_in_idea.hprof
-Xbootclasspath/a:../lib/boot.jar

编辑保存:

vi /Applications/IntelliJ\ IDEA.app/Contents/bin/idea.vmoptions

重新启动,开心的撸代码去吧!

PS:

http://blog.csdn.net/kl28978113/article/details/53031710

转载于:https://www.cnblogs.com/phpdragon/p/7406125.html

IntellIJ IDEA 启动 参数 配置相关推荐

  1. log4j异步mysql_log4j2用Log4jContextSelector启动参数配置全局异步日志是如何使用disruptor...

    与 log4j2用asyncRoot配置异步日志是如何使用disruptor差异有几个: 给disruptor实例的EventFactory不同 此处EventFactory采用的是RingBuffe ...

  2. JVM启动参数配置详解

    JVM启动参数配置详解 1. JDK8的JVM启动参数默认配置 2. JDK8的JVM启动参数说明 2.1 基本参数 2.2 G1相关参数 2.3 辅助信息 1. JDK8的JVM启动参数默认配置 - ...

  3. SpringBoot笔记:SpringBoot启动参数配置

    文章目录 目的 测试代码 配置文件配置 获取自定义参数 项目打包发布 修改启动配置 方式一:系统变量 方式二:命令行参数 springboot启动参数解释 目的 1.熟悉springboot多环境配置 ...

  4. java 启动参数 配置,java程序启动参数设置

    有些时候我们需要在java程序启动时设置一些系统属性值,然后程序启动后可以获取这些系统属性值并进行一些逻辑处理.例如我们在使用Maven打包的时候如果想跳过test执行,可以使用如下命令: mvn c ...

  5. php-fpm 的参数,php-fpm启动参数配置详解

    pid = run/php-fpm.pid #pid设置,默认在安装目录中的var/run/php-fpm.pid,建议开启 error_log = log/php-fpm.log #错误日志,默认在 ...

  6. tomcat java垃圾回收_tomcat启动参数配置,内存和垃圾回收

    一般情况下: JAVA_OPTS='-Xms2048m -Xmx2048m -XX:MaxPermSize=512m -XX:+UseParallelGC -XX:ParallelGCThreads= ...

  7. 日志解析LogParse启动参数配置

    -task task_stat1001to1010.yaml -log log4j_stat1001to1010.xml 用绝对路径 转载于:https://www.cnblogs.com/orco/ ...

  8. Erlang启动参数学习

    项目中脚本里大量使用erlang的启动参数配置,今天来学习一下关于erlang的启动参数 官方API 先贴出官方API的地址 前言 erlang启动参数主要有3种,分别是emulator flag, ...

  9. docker加速器添加启动参数报错

    在通过添加docker daemon启动参数配置docker加速器时启动报如下错误 docker.service has more than one ExecStart= setting, which ...

最新文章

  1. Java 项目UML反向工程转化工具
  2. 百融金服榕树_百融金服榕树成为拉动新金融行业增长的主力军
  3. 第四篇[机器学习] 机器学习,线性回归的优化
  4. 第一届河北工业大学程序设计竞赛校赛 【个别题的解析】
  5. 文件上传功能-本地存储、阿里OSS、七牛云
  6. mysql 5.5.46_MySQL 5.5.46源码安装
  7. [jQuery] jQuery UI怎样自定义组件?
  8. 赠书 | SkyWalking 观测 Service Mesh 技术大公开
  9. java代码修改触发编译_gcc -O0仍然优化了“未使用”的代码 . 是否有一个编译标志来改变它?...
  10. 【今日CS 视觉论文速览】14 Dec 2018
  11. 使用performance monitor 查看 每一个cpu core的cpu time
  12. socket 关于同一条TCP链接数据包到达顺序的问题
  13. matlab+sfm+样例,基于SFM的三维重建MATLAB程序
  14. 使用C#代码实现增加用户帐号
  15. 视频编辑专家下载v9.3官方免费版
  16. axis调用webservice服务
  17. ubuntu各个版本
  18. 用计算机语言写结婚祝福语,[结婚电子显示屏祝福语]电子显示屏结婚贺词
  19. 《小鑫发现》之GraphQL框架Prisma
  20. 电脑回收站删除的文件还能找回吗 电脑回收站删除的文件怎么恢复

热门文章

  1. Part 2 — Making Sense of Smart Contracts
  2. A quick complete tutorial to save and restore Tensorflow models
  3. 安卓代码跟踪方式学习笔记
  4. layui select下拉框改变之 change 监听事件
  5. java远程操作ftp服务器上传下载
  6. JZOJ 5478. 【NOIP2017提高组正式赛】列队
  7. JZOJ 5286. 【NOIP2017提高A组模拟8.16】花花的森林
  8. JZOJ 4933. 【NOIP2017提高组模拟12.24】C
  9. Qt多线程 TCP 服务端
  10. [codevs 1302] 小矮人(2002年CEOI中欧信息学奥赛)